Actual nearshore water temperatures may fluctuate by several degrees from the reported values, especially following heavy rainfall or extended periods of strong winds. Certain wind patterns can cause colder, deeper waters to rise and replace the sun-warmed surface water, leading to noticeable variations.

Location & Local Information

#Norfolk

Hardley Flood, set within the Norfolk Broads landscape, tends to have cool water for much of the year. In spring temperatures typically range from about 6–12 °C (43–54 °F) as rivers and runoff remain chilly; summer water may warm to roughly 15–22 °C (59–72 °F) on average, with occasional warm spells pushing mid-20s °C (mid-70s °F). Autumn sees a decline to around 10–16 °C (50–61 °F), while winter values commonly sit near 4–8 °C (39–46 °F), and wind, shading and reed cover can make the water feel colder than the thermometer suggests.

Swimming is generally discouraged and not permitted at Hardley Flood because it is a protected wildlife reserve with sensitive reedbeds, variable depths, submerged vegetation and potential currents; visitors should follow on-site signage and local guidance, and use designated bathing sites for safety and conservation. Those visiting for outdoor recreation can still enjoy the wider Norfolk Broads, boat hire and guided cruises, extensive birdwatching at nearby wetlands such as Breydon Water, and riverside walking routes and visitor centres in the area.

Is it possible to swim in Hardley Flood (United Kingdom) and what are the possibilities for this?
Swimming at Hardley Flood is not a formal activity — there are no designated bathing facilities and because it is a protected nature reserve with sensitive wildlife any wild swimming would be at your own risk and generally discouraged unless explicitly permitted by the site managers.
